薛立軍
級別: 家園?
![]() |
各位師傅你好:連續運轉的設備。我需要的動(dòng)作是X3每觸發(fā)一次,X0、1接的高速計數器當前值被讀取并加456。 X3觸發(fā)1次稱(chēng)為N1(計數器當前值加456)觸發(fā)2次N2(計數器當前值再加456)觸發(fā)是N次 高速計數器當前值到N1是Y0輸出0.01S。然后是N+1如此循環(huán)。計數器加到最大益處如何處理,計數器N1輸出 結束就不再使用,換N2如此下推。 怎樣處理? |
---|---|
|
rockyhuo
專(zhuān)業(yè)制造全伺服高速衛生巾機器
級別: 論壇先鋒
![]() ![]() |
按你的運算速度是有溢出機會(huì ),沒(méi)辦法,只能找計算64位的數據的PLC,或者你用浮點(diǎn)運算試試 |
|
---|---|---|
|
xuefenfeilxw
級別: 略有小成
![]() |
假如計數器從0開(kāi)始計數到2147483647 ;那么你的連續計數次數最大值 = 2147483647/456=4709393 當你計數到第4709394次(或計數當前值>2147483208)的時(shí)候要對計數器重新賦值 = 2147483647 — 數器當前值 + 456 就可以拉! |
---|---|
|
薛立軍
級別: 家園?
![]() |
謝了。! |
---|---|
|
薛立軍
級別: 家園?
![]() |
主要是讀取計數器當前值+不定值X,然后計數器到當前值+不定值X,輸出信號。 問(wèn)題是連續讀取,連續輸出。計數器到當前值+不定值X,輸出動(dòng)作以后不再使用。保存當前值,和讀取當前值的寄存器怎樣做? |
---|---|
|
nazid1231
學(xué)習中!成長(cháng)中!
級別: 略有小成
![]() |
你們公司就沒(méi)個(gè)師傅帶帶你? |
---|---|
|